TABLE 2.
Reviews of articles by predefined categories: data quality, study design and data source, causal inference from the climate change knowledge base for food- and waterborne diseases, 1998–2009
| Reviews | Campylobacter | Salmonella | Listeria | Vibrio | Cryptosporidium | Norovirus |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Data quality | ||||||
| High | 81 | 65 | 17 | 16 | 27 | 48 |
| Moderate | 85 | 98 | 34 | 33 | 53 | 33 |
| Low | 2 | 7 | 3 | 6 | 7 | 3 |
| Very low | __ | 1 | __ | __ | __ | 1 |
| Not classified | 4 | 20 | 2 | 3 | 3 | 9 |
| Study design | ||||||
| Meta-analyses | 19 | 8 | 2 | 3 | 11 | 15 |
| Review | 40 | 40 | 11 | 22 | 36 | 8 |
| Randomized controlled trial | 2 | 1 | __ | __ | 2 | 2 |
| Nonrandomized intervention study | __ | __ | __ | 1 | __ | __ |
| Cohort study | 9 | 6 | 1 | __ | 1 | 6 |
| Case-control study | 11 | 14 | 2 | __ | 3 | 2 |
| Cross-sectional (survey) | 3 | 2 | 1 | __ | 1 | 4 |
| Ecological study | 13 | 10 | 1 | 10 | 2 | 2 |
| Case study | 31 | 15 | 2 | 4 | 12 | 11 |
| Expert opinion | __ | 2 | __ | 1 | __ | 1 |
| In vivo experiment | 10 | 13 | 2 | 1 | 2 | 3 |
| In vitro experiment | 4 | 14 | 18 | __ | 3 | 1 |
| Molecular evidence | 2 | 1 | 2 | __ | 2 | 9 |
| Outbreak | 11 | 21 | 2 | 1 | 4 | 6 |
| Data source | __ | __ | __ | __ | __ | 4 |
| Other | 15 | 24 | 10 | 15 | 7 | 11 |
| Not classified | 2 | 20 | 2 | __ | 4 | 9 |
| Casual inference | ||||||
| Direct | 84 | 56 | 16 | 22 | 22 | 40 |
| Moderate | 57 | 58 | 10 | 19 | 39 | 31 |
| Indirect | 29 | 57 | 28 | 17 | 26 | 15 |
| Not classified | 2 | 20 | 2 | __ | 3 | 8 |
Note. The numbers represent reviews conducted by independent reviewers and not the number of peer reviewed articles; categories may overlap (e.g., multiple pathogens per study).
